Archaeogenetics
Summary
Archaeogenetics is the study of
ancient DNA
to understand the
genetic history
of
past populations
, providing insights into
human evolution
, migration patterns, and the
domestication of plants
and animals. By analyzing
genetic material
from
archaeological remains
, researchers can reconstruct genealogies and trace the
lineage of ancient species
, offering a
molecular perspective
on
historical events
and
cultural transformations
.
